UN in Egypt Launches "Role of Media in Achieving Sustainable Goals" Program


Thu 24 Jun 2021 | 03:39 PM

The fourth phase of "Role of Media in Achieving Sustainable Goals‏"  workshop has been launched by the UN in Egypt to enhance its corporation with media and inform Journalists with development agenda and sustainable development goals.

Also in this regard, the UN has been encouraging Journalists to realize its Development Goals approaches.

In her address at the launch, UN Resident Coordinator in Egypt Elena Panova said: "On the behave of the UN in Egypt, I want to thank the journalists for their participation in this workshop."

"We share various sustainable goals and aspirations. The UN institution's partnerships with the Egyptian authorities and citizens are far-reaching and longstanding," Panova added.

For her part, Nehal El-kady, the UN's Communication Officer said: “The meeting was an opportunity to meet with various media channels to discuss the recent achievements of UN’s programs in Egypt amid the corona-virus novel.”

"We believe that partnering with Egypt’s journalists is one of our most important priorities because it is you who are reshaping public awareness and driving the future of this nation," Mohamed ElKosy, a UN counselor for this initiative.

"By bringing the UN institutions and Media together, initiatives like this can deepen collaboration on issues that matter and cultivate a stronger sense of community," ElKosy told Sada Elbald English.

“Like many countries around the world, Egypt has been impacted by the COVID-19,” Iman Amer, a UN Bureau in Egypt representative.

"Thus, various programs of the UN have been postponed due to COVID-19," she added.

She also spoke on the role of the UN over the last decades in supporting Egypt’s development – in education, health system, and its human capital development.

"UN wants quality education, gender, good jobs, and an ability to raise and educate children and elder girls that can, in turn, aspire to greater things," Amer added.

Speaking during the workshop, Chief of Education, Programme Division UNICEF Headquarters Amira Fouad said that we know from conversations and discussions with sophisticated journalists like yourselves that many Egyptian institutions care about addressing domestic challenges such as those you tackled as a part of UN Sustainable Development Goal projects.
